What is cloud hosting? And why multi-cloud hosting is the future : Definition from Digimagg
Cloud hosting delivers reliable website performance and scalability, utilizing a network of servers to ensure high uptime and fast load speeds.
In July 2018, Amazon incurred an estimated loss of US$100 million due to an hour-long downtime during its Prime Day Sales. In August 2020, server outages impacted Google, affecting both the company and the productivity of businesses relying on its tools. Another global outage in May 2021 temporarily disrupted 10% of the internet, impacting eCommerce giants like Amazon and eBay.
In response to such potentially damaging incidents, cloud hosting has evolved. In our interconnected world, businesses depend on a reliable global web infrastructure offering advanced website security and business continuity. While 100% uptime cannot be guaranteed, multi-cloud hosting comes close.
For those considering website creation, opting for a hosting solution with multi-cloud hosting ensures reliability and site performance. In this article, we delve into multi-cloud hosting and its suitability for businesses of all sizes, from enterprises to small businesses.
Understanding Your Requirements for Web Hosting
When selecting the most suitable web hosting option, it's crucial to understand the distinctions between various types available, as each offers unique features and benefits that may or may not align with your requirements.
Historically, many novice website creators favored shared hosting, where multiple sites are hosted on one server. This cost-effective option is suitable for small sites, such as personal websites, with modest traffic volumes.
As websites and businesses grow, medium-sized businesses often explore alternatives like VPS hosting, which provides a private, dedicated space and resources on a shared server. While less susceptible to traffic surges, VPS hosting tends to be more expensive than shared hosting. However, it may not be suitable for enterprises or busy eCommerce sites and lacks the reliability of dedicated web servers.
Cloud hosting, on the other hand, has evolved to accommodate websites of all sizes. Offering the ability to manage sudden traffic spikes, ensure 99.9% uptime, eliminate single points of failure, and scale with your website, cloud hosting is a versatile option. Some providers, like Wix, even offer cloud hosting at no cost. For a detailed comparison of cloud hosting versus shared hosting, refer to our guide.
Understanding Cloud Hosting
Web hosting involves storing your website on a physical server and delivering it to users' browsers. Cloud hosting operates similarly, but your site is hosted on a network of virtual servers instead of a physical one, as part of the broader concept of cloud computing. Public cloud services and hosting providers like Microsoft Azure, IBM Cloud, and Amazon EC2 offer cloud hosting options, each with varying reliability and costs. Cloud hosting offers advantages over non-cloud hosting, such as increased flexibility in terms of storage and bandwidth scalability to accommodate short-term surges or long-term business growth.
What is multi-cloud hosting?
Multi-cloud hosting enhances traditional cloud hosting by providing enterprise-grade performance and reliability to businesses of all sizes and locations. With multi-cloud hosting, your hosting provider integrates public cloud services such as Google Cloud and Amazon Web Services (AWS) with private and in-house servers to host your website. Additionally, the provider actively manages potential outages and distributes traffic loads across networks and servers.
The primary advantage of multi-cloud hosting is reliability, ensuring that your website remains operational without any intervention on your part. For instance, Wix's multi-cloud hosting solution utilizes Amazon Web Services (AWS), Google Cloud, and Wix's own servers. In the event of a temporary outage on AWS, websites hosted on AWS would seamlessly switch to Google Cloud. If both AWS and Google Cloud experience issues, Wix's in-house servers would take over hosting responsibilities, ensuring uninterrupted business operations.
Benefits of Multi-Cloud Hosting
When beginning to build your website, it's essential to explore the advantages of multi-cloud hosting. Here, we outline the benefits of multi-cloud hosting for websites of various sizes.
Simplified Management
Multi-cloud hosting entails complex management and substantial expenses to connect various public and private clouds. Fortunately, opting for a multi-cloud hosting service grants you the advantages of this technology without the need to invest your own time or resources. Most multi-cloud hosting providers offer automatic website backup and recovery in the event of online outages or disasters, minimizing downtime and swiftly restoring your business online.
Tip: Wix offers fully-managed hosting and multi-cloud services, requiring minimal effort from you. With Wix, the War Room operates 24/7 to proactively address potential server and network outages, supplemented by support from Google and AWS cloud services.
Dependability and Expandability
Cloud hosting offers reliability, with providers like Wix delivering uptime rates of 99.99%, ensuring business continuity. Additionally, automatic site backup ensures that your website can quickly restore even in rare network outages, safeguarding your brand reputation during traffic spikes and server downtime.
Moreover, cloud hosting provides scalability through multi-cloud hosting, utilizing a network of internal, public, and private clouds to manage and distribute data to websites. As your website's traffic and sales increase and your business requirements evolve, multi-cloud hosting dynamically adjusts to manage sudden traffic surges through load balancing.
Enhanced Website Speed
Both users and search engines expect fast website performance. Providing a positive user experience hinges on delivering content within seconds, whether it's streaming a video or completing a purchase. Cloud hosting employs geo-clustering, positioning servers in close proximity to users via a network of content delivery networks (CDNs). This results in faster page load speeds and increased customer engagement.